Barbaresco
Castello di Verduno

Barbaresco, 2022

Available Vintages
justerini & brooks tasting note

Always a delicate drinkable style of Barbaresco with good intensity of flavour whisked along by light, crisp acidity and tannin. A blend of predominantly Faset (90%) and declassified Rabaja and Rabaja Bas, all in the Barbaresco commune. Fermented in stainless steel with 30 days of skin contact and aged for 18 months in large casks.

critic reviews

92/100Antonio Galloni,Vinous

The 2022 Barbaresco is a gracious, classy wine that captures the essence of the house style. Crushed flowers, sweet, red-toned fruit, orange peel, spice and rose petals are some of the notes that grace this understated, sensual Barbaresco. Soft tannins add to a feeling of approachability. What a pretty and engaging wine this is.

DRINKING WINDOW 2024 - 2033
date of review 10/2024
